Solution for 3(14+-1y)-y=22 equation:


Simplifying
3(14 + -1y) + -1y = 22
(14 * 3 + -1y * 3) + -1y = 22
(42 + -3y) + -1y = 22

Combine like terms: -3y + -1y = -4y
42 + -4y = 22

Solving
42 + -4y = 22

Solving for variable 'y'.

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-42' to each side of the equation.
42 + -42 + -4y = 22 + -42

Combine like terms: 42 + -42 = 0
0 + -4y = 22 + -42
-4y = 22 + -42

Combine like terms: 22 + -42 = -20
-4y = -20

Divide each side by '-4'.
y = 5

Simplifying
y = 5
